Alexis Sanchez ended a four-and-a-half-year Champions League goal drought, with the last goal scored in February 2017

Live bar November 4 news In the Champions League group stage in the early hours of this morning Beijing time, Sanchez scored a goal to help Inter beat Sharif 3-1 away.

According to media statistics, this is Sanchez's first Champions League goal in nearly four and a half years, and the last time he scored in the Champions League dates back to Arsenal's match against Bayern in February 2017, when the Chilean shooter scored a goal for the Gunners, but in the end Arsenal lost 5-1.
